1. A system comprising:

  • a plurality of processing units associated with a plurality of actors participating in an activity, wherein each respective actor of the actors having one or more sensors in communication with a respective processing unit among the plurality of processing units, the respective processing unit configured to process sensor data from the one or more sensors to identify patterns in the sensor data used to identify a state of the respective actor, wherein the state comprises action performance characteristics of an athletic maneuver;

    at least one interface to communicate with the processing units, receive from the processing units data identifying states of the actors determined from sensors attached to the actors, and communicate with a camera;

    at least one microprocessor; and

    a memory storing instructions configured to instruct the at least one microprocessor to;

    select an actor from the plurality of actors based on the states of the actors in response to action performance characteristics of a current state of the actor matching with or predicting a predefined athletic maneuver; and

    adjust, via the at least one interface, an operation parameter of the camera to focus on the actor selected from the plurality of actors, based on the data identifying the states of the actors matching with or predicting the predefined athletic maneuver.
